niusouti.com

以下有关操作系统的叙述,正确的是______。A.用P、V操作可以解决互斥与同步问题B.只要同一信号量上的P、V操作成对地出现,就可以防止引起死锁C.虚存就是把一个实存空间变为多个用户内存空间分配给用户作业使用,使得每个用户作业都感到好像自己独占一个内存D.在一个单处理机中,最多只能允许有两个进程处于运行状态

题目

以下有关操作系统的叙述,正确的是______。

A.用P、V操作可以解决互斥与同步问题

B.只要同一信号量上的P、V操作成对地出现,就可以防止引起死锁

C.虚存就是把一个实存空间变为多个用户内存空间分配给用户作业使用,使得每个用户作业都感到好像自己独占一个内存

D.在一个单处理机中,最多只能允许有两个进程处于运行状态


相似考题
更多“以下有关操作系统的叙述,正确的是______。A.用P、V操作可以解决互斥与同步问题B.只要同一信号量上 ”相关问题
  • 第1题:

    若有一个仓库,可以存放P1和P2两种产品,但是每次只能存放一种产品。要求:

    ①w=P1的数量-P2的数量

    ②-i<w<k(i,k为正整数)

    若用PV操作实现P1和P2产品的入库过程,至少需要(1)个同步信号量及(2)个互斥信号量,其中,同步信号量的初值分别为(3),互斥信号量的初值分别为(4)。

    A.0

    B.1

    C.2

    D.3


    正确答案:C
    解析:同步是指进程间共同完成一项任务时直接发生相互作用的关系,即具有伙伴关系的进程在执行时间次序上必须遵循的规律。互斥是指进程因竞争同一资源而相互制约。
      在本题中,相当于P1和P2 2种产品竞争同一仓库。
      设置2个同步信号量Sp1和Sp2,Sp1表示存放产品P1,其初值为i-1(因为i为正整数,没有存放时为0);Sp2表示存放产品P2,其初值为k-1。
      因为只有1个仓库,所以只需要设置1个互斥信号量,其初值为1。

  • 第2题:

    信号量机制是一种有效地实现进程同步与互斥的工具。信号量只能由P、V操作来改变。()

    此题为判断题(对,错)。


    参考答案:对

  • 第3题:

    操作系统通常采用(228)解决进程间合作和资源共享所带来的同步与互斥问题。若在系统中有若干个互斥资源R,5个并发进程,每个进程都需要5个资源R,那么使系统不发生死锁的资源R的最少数日为(229)。

    A.调度

    B.共享资源

    C.信号量

    D.通讯


    正确答案:C

  • 第4题:

    有一个仓库可以存放P1、P2两种产品,但是每次只能存放一种产品。要求:

    ①w=P1的数量-P2的数量;

    ②-1<w<k(i、k为正整数)。

    若用P/V操作实现P1和P2产品的入库过程,则至少需要上(26)个同步信号量及(27)个互斥信号量。其中,同步信号量的初值分别为(28),互斥信号量的初值分别为(29)。

    A.0

    B.1

    C.2

    D.3


    正确答案:C
    解析:同步是指进程间共同完成一项任务时直接发生相互作用的关系,即具有伙伴关系的进程在执行时间次序上必须遵循的规律。互斥是指进程因竞争同一资源而相互制约。在本题中,相当于P1和P2两种产品竞争同一仓库。设置2个同步信号量SP1和SP2,SP1表示存放产品P1,其初值为i-1(因为i为正整数,没有存放时为0):SP2表示存放产品P2,其初值为k-1。因为只有1个仓库,所以只需要设置1个互斥信号量,其初值为1。

  • 第5题:

    为了防止与时间有关的错误,操作系统引入()机制,控制相关的并发进程,使它们按正确的顺序运行。

    A.并发

    B.同步、互斥


    参考答案:B

  • 第6题:

    解决进程同步与互斥问题时,对信号量进行P原语操作是在下列哪类代码区完成的?

    A.进入区

    B.临界区

    C.退出区

    D.剩余区


    正确答案:A

  • 第7题:

    信号量机制是一种有效的实现进程同步与互斥的工具。信号量只能由P、V操作来改变。


    正确答案:正确

  • 第8题:

    在进程同步中,不能对信号量进行操作的是()。

    • A、初始化信号量
    • B、P操作
    • C、V操作
    • D、加减操作

    正确答案:D

  • 第9题:

    下列对进程互斥概念的表述正确的是()。

    • A、若进程A和B在临界区上互斥,则当A位于临界区内时,可以被B打断
    • B、信号量是初值为零的整型变量,可对其作加l和减l操作
    • C、信号量是1个整型变量,对其只能作P和V操作
    • D、在临界区内,可以对两个进程同时进行P操作

    正确答案:C

  • 第10题:

    判断题
    信号量机制是一种有效的实现进程同步与互斥的工具。信号量只能由P、V操作来改变。
    A

    B


    正确答案:
    解析: 暂无解析

  • 第11题:

    单选题
    用P、V操作可以解决(  )互斥问题。
    A

    一切

    B

    某些

    C

    正确

    D

    错误


    正确答案: A
    解析:

  • 第12题:

    单选题
    在解决进程同步和互斥的问题时,对信号量进行V原语操作是在下列哪一个代码区进行的?()
    A

    进入区

    B

    临界区

    C

    退出区

    D

    剩余区


    正确答案: C
    解析: 暂无解析

  • 第13题:

    操作系统在使用信号量解决同步与互斥问题中,若P(或wAit)、V(或signAl)操作的信号量S初值为3,当前值为-2,则表示有( )等待进程。

    A 0个

    B 1个

    C 2个

    D 3个


    参考答案C

  • 第14题:

    用P、V操作可以解决进程间的各种同步和互斥问题,下列说法中( )是正确的。

    Ⅰ.两个P操作的顺序无关紧要

    Ⅱ.用于互斥的P操作应用于同步的P操作之前

    Ⅲ.用于同步的P操作应用于互斥的P操作之前

    A.只有Ⅰ

    B.只有Ⅱ

    C.只有Ⅲ

    D.都不正确


    正确答案:C

  • 第15题:

    下列说法中,正确的是

    A.进程之间同步,主要源于进程之间的资源竞争,是指对多个相关进程在执行次序上的协调

    B.信号量机制是一种有效的实现进程同步与互斥的工具。信号量只能由P\V.操作来改变

    C.V操作是对信号量执行加1操作,意味着释放一个单位资源,加1后如果信号量的值小于等于0,则从等待队列中唤醒一个进程,现进程变为等待状态;否则现进程继续进行

    D.临界区是指每次仅允许一个进程访问的资源


    正确答案:B
    解析:A:注意同步和互斥的区别;C:V操作加1后如果信号量的值小于等于0,则唤醒一个进程,否则进程继续执行;D:注意区分临界区和临界资源。

  • 第16题:

    若有一个仓库,可以存放P1,P2两种产品,但是每次只能存放一种产品。要求:

    ①w=P1的数量-P2的数量

    ②-i 若用P-V操作实现P1和P2产品的入库过程,至少需要(49)个同步信号量及

    (50)个互斥信号量,其中,同步信号量的初值分别为(51),互斥信号量的初值分别为(52)。

    A.0

    B.1

    C.2

    D.3


    正确答案:C

  • 第17题:

    ()是一种只能由P、V原语操作的特殊变量。

    A.调度

    B.进程

    C.同步

    D.信号量


    参考答案:D

  • 第18题:

    信号量机制是一种有效的实现进程同步与互斥的工具。信号量只能由P、V操作来改变。

    A

    B



  • 第19题:

    在解决进程同步和互斥的问题时,对信号量进行V原语操作是在下列哪一个代码区进行的?()

    • A、进入区
    • B、临界区
    • C、退出区
    • D、剩余区

    正确答案:C

  • 第20题:

    操作系统中利用信号量和P、V操作,()。

    • A、只能实现进程的互斥
    • B、只能实现进程的同步
    • C、可实现进程的互斥和同步
    • D、可完成进程调度

    正确答案:C

  • 第21题:

    单选题
    下列对进程互斥概念的表述正确的是()。
    A

    若进程A和B在临界区上互斥,则当A位于临界区内时,可以被B打断

    B

    信号量是初值为零的整型变量,可对其作加l和减l操作

    C

    信号量是1个整型变量,对其只能作P和V操作

    D

    在临界区内,可以对两个进程同时进行P操作


    正确答案: D
    解析: A中两进程在临界区互斥,则必须等一个完成之后才能启动另一个。
    B中信号量的初值是整型,不一定是0。
    D中临界区内只能操作一个进程。

  • 第22题:

    多选题
    涉及PV操作的正确说法是()
    A

    PV操作只能解决进程互斥问题

    B

    PV操作只能解决进程同步问题

    C

    PV操作能用于解决进程互斥问题,也能解决进程同步问题

    D

    PV操作不能解决进程通信问题

    E

    PV操作是一种只交换少量信息的低级通信方式


    正确答案: E,D
    解析: 暂无解析

  • 第23题:

    单选题
    操作系统中利用信号量和P、V操作,()。
    A

    只能实现进程的互斥

    B

    只能实现进程的同步

    C

    可实现进程的互斥和同步

    D

    可完成进程调度


    正确答案: D
    解析: 暂无解析